Day 3: London - Edinburgh
Greetings as we begin a full day's drive through English countryside and the Northumberland National Park on our journey to the Scottish border. Our first stop in Scotland is Jedburgh, famous for its beautiful Abbey. Later, we have a chance to visit the Woollen Mills before we continue to Edinburgh - Scotland's elegant capital. We enjoy a welcome gathering with our Tour Director this evening. We spend the next two evenings at the Royal Scot Hotel.
Day 4: Around Edinburgh
This morning our sightseeing tour visits Edinburgh Castle and views Holyrood Palace, once home of Mary Queen of Scots. Later, we explore the Royal Mile and Princes Street. Then with time on your own maybe take an excursion to a nearby Stately Home. Tonight, why not join in an optional Scottish evening with dinner, Highland dancing and bagpipes?
Day 5: Edinburgh - Strathpeffer
We drive over the Forth Bridge to the Fife Coast and St. Andrews, a picturesque University town and home of the famous golf course. We continue our journey over the River Tay, through Dundee and Perth to Pitlochry before driving via Blair Atholl to Culloden Moor scene of the 1746 defeat of Bonnie Prince Charlie. Finally, on to the Highland town of Strathpeffer.
Day 6: Highlands & Isle of Skye Excursion
We travel to the banks of Loch Ness, keep your eyes open for 'Nessie'. Then along the shores of Loch Cluanie and through Glen Shiel where the Five Sisters of Kintail surge up to heights of 3,000 feet. We visit Eilean Donan Castle before crossing to the Isle of Skye where we have a chance to see some of this beautiful island. Later we return to the mainland and travel via Loch Carron and Achnasheen back to Strathpeffer for the night.
Day 7: Strathpeffer - Glasgow
Today enjoy a scenic drive past Fort William with views of Ben Nevis, Britain's highest peak en route to Glencoe. This breathtaking glen is the site of the famous Macdonald massacre in 1692 where many of the Macdonald Clan were killed by the troops of William the Third. We have a chance to see the Clan Memorial before we drive along the 'bonnie banks' of Loch Lomond. Perhaps enjoy a cruise on this romantic lake before we arrive in Scotland's largest city Glasgow. We enjoy dinner at world famous Harry Ramsden's this evening.
Day 8: Lowlands Excursion
Today we enjoy an excursion to Ayrshire on the Firth of Clyde. Our first stop is at Alloway to see the thatched cottage where the famous Scottish poet Robbie Burns was born in 1759. Across the road is the roofless ruins of Alloway church where Robbie's father is buried and made famous in his poem Tam O'Shanter. Afterwards we visit Culzean Castle seat of the Kennedys' since the 15th Century. The castle was remodeled in 1777 taking 15 years to complete. Walk the oval staircase and enjoy the spectacular views and if time allows explore the country park surrounding the Castle. We return to Glasgow with time to shop.
Day 9: Glasgow - London
This morning we travel south stopping to visit Gretna Green, renowned for allowing eloping couples to wed against their parents' wishes. Then, once back into England, we cross the mountains of Cumbria, and on through the Midlands arriving back in London early evening.
